How to Reach Vilanant, Spain

Vilanant is a charming village located in the province of Girona, Catalonia, Spain. If you're planning a visit to this beautiful destination, here are some ways to reach Vilanant:

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Vilanant is Girona-Costa Brava Airport.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to reach Vilanant, which is approximately a 40-minute drive away.

By Train:

Vilanant doesn't have its own train station, but you can take a train to Figueres, which is the nearest major city. From Figueres, you can either hire a taxi or take a local bus to Vilanant, which is just a short distance away.

By Bus:

There are regular bus services available from various cities in the region to Vilanant. You can check the schedule and book your tickets in advance to ensure a smooth journey.

By Car:

If you prefer to drive, Vilanant is easily accessible by car. The village is well-connected to the major roads and highways in the region. You can use GPS or follow the road signs to reach Vilanant.

By Bicycle:

Vilanant is located in a picturesque countryside, making it a popular destination for cycling enthusiasts. You can rent a bicycle in nearby towns or bring your own to explore the scenic routes leading to Vilanant.

Vilanant, Spain: A Charming Village Steeped in History

Nestled in the heart of Catalonia, Vilanant is a picturesque village located in the northeastern part of Spain. With its rich historical heritage and scenic beauty, this charming destination attracts visitors from near and far.

One of the highlights of Vilanant is its well-preserved medieval town center. As you wander through its narrow cobbled streets, you'll feel as if you've stepped back in time. The village is home to numerous historic buildings, including the Sant Martí Church, which dates back to the 12th century and boasts stunning Romanesque architecture.

The natural surroundings of Vilanant are equally captivating. The village is surrounded by lush green countryside, with rolling hills and vineyards stretching as far as the eye can see. This makes it a perfect destination for outdoor enthusiasts, who can indulge in activities such as hiking, cycling, or simply taking leisurely strolls through the scenic landscapes.

Vilanant is also renowned for its gastronomy. The local cuisine reflects the culinary traditions of Catalonia, with an emphasis on fresh and local ingredients. Visitors can savor traditional dishes such as fideuà, a seafood and noodle-based dish, or botifarra amb seques, a hearty sausage and bean stew.
